The ingredients needed to make Native meal (ACHA):
  1. Take Acha
  2. Take Water as much
  3. Take Maggi
  4. Make ready Salt a pinch to taste
  5. Get Curry powder
  6. Get Ginger and garlic powder little
  7. Take Palm oil
  8. Take Pepper as much
  9. Take Onion 1/2 bulb

Steps to make Native meal (ACHA):
  1. Put palm oil on fire, cut onion and fry a little in palm oil
  2. Blend or cut pepper and fry with onion then add three cups if water into oil
  3. Add maggi, salt, ginger and garlic powder, with curry powder into water and allow to boil
  4. Wash acha thoroughly to remove stones and pour into boiling water and stir
  5. Stir till it begins to get strong, then cover pot and allow to cook also for water to drain.
  6. Acha meal us ready and did delicious when served and eaten hot.
